Conditions

After PCI Surgery

Interventions

Group A:Rehabilitation exercise program
Group B:Discharged from the hospital for 1 to 2 weeks: to guide patients to carry out postoperative rehabilitation exercise, to guide patients to respiratory training and the method and frequency of
Group C:Adjustment period (patient discharge from hospital - 3 months): cultivation exercise habits, master the right exercise side. Guide patients to choose the right exercise formula style, frequen
Group D:Adaptation period (3 to 6 months of discharge): mainly encourages patients to maintain long-term regular rehabilitation habits and promote health.

Eligibility

Sex/Gender
All

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Compliant with WHO's diagnostic criteria for coronary heart disease, first-time PCI, aged >= 18 years; 2. The exercise risk of patients with coronary heart disease is stratified to low and medium-risk; 3. Patients undergoing PCI for the first time; 4. Accessible limb movement; 5. EF > 40%; 6. Patients are conscious, have basic reading and writing skills, and can communicate normally; 7. Voluntary to participate in this study and sign an informed consent form.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Severe ch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, pneumonia, bronchitis; 2. People with severe complications, such as heart failure, cardiac shock and severe arrhythmias; 3. Greater than 75% of the remaining vascular stenosis after PCI; 4. Patients undergoing PCI for the first time.
